HALAWA, Hawaii (Island News) – Local families torn apart by incarceration, were gifted with an emotional Easter treat this weekend at the Halawa Correctional Facility.
The facility’s first Easter Keiki Day, hosted on Saturday, Apr. 12, gave incarcerated fathers an opportunity to reunite with their loved ones, after months apart.
The intimate event was made possible through a collaboration with Keiki O Ka ʻĀina (KOKA) Family Learning Centers – with a goal to provide a special celebration of love and connection.
